Abstract:We introduce layering to modal type theory to combine type theory with intensional analysis. In particular, we demonstrate this idea by developing a 2-layered modal type theory. At the core of this type theory (layer 0) is a simply typed $$\lambda $$
λ
-calculus with no modality. Layer 1 is obtained by extending the core language with one layer of contextual $$\square $$
□
types to support pattern matching on potentially open code from layer … Show more
